April - Pre Season

Posted on April 13, 2012 by Captain John Sharp

Well, the season is only about a week away. The boat is in the water and all the systems are being checked. I will be taking the fishing gear down to the marina this weekend and spend the rest of the time getting everything ready. We seem to be in pretty good shape and on schedule to be ready with days to spare.
As far as the fishing is concerned, according to the DNR website, the water temperature is around 54 degrees and alot of pre spawn rock are making their way up into the estuaries. There has been a lot of talk about how the warm spring will impact the fishing. Every year, there is always a lot of pre season anxiety about how things will go and in the end, every year has a different result. Until then, there is just speculation. The only thing for certain is that the annual spawning and migration patterns remain the same. Personally, I am just anxious to get started.

March

Posted on March 07, 2012 by Captain John Sharp

The season is only six weeks away and I am starting to get really busy. Although most of the trophy season is already booked, I do still have some open dates. The calendar is up to date, so you can look to see what is available. Of course, the best thing to do is to always call me.
I am really looking forward to this year. We are not doing any big jobs on the boat, so everything will be ready to go in plenty of time. Over the next few weeks, we will get her back in the water and get everything ready.
Although it is a little bit early to get any reliable fishing reports, everyone is hopefull that there will be a good run of big fish. According to the DNR website, the water temperature in the upper rivers is still around 50 degrees, which is still a little cool for the the fish to spawn. That is good as we don't want things to happen too soon.
